Overview:
VMware vCenter™ Lifecycle Manager, part of the VMware
vCenter family of management products, automates virtual
machine provisioning tasks, enabling IT administrators
to minimize manual repetitive tasks, standardize processes
and optimize resource utilization.

How Does VMware Lifecycle Manager Work?
VMware vCenter Lifecycle Manager provides an easy-to-use
Web interface for managing the interactions among everyone
involved in the lifecycle of a virtual machine, from
provisioning to decommissioning. During setup, IT administrators
create a catalog of virtual machine templates that users
can view and select. The templates help users determine
the characteristics of available virtual machines (machine
size, memory, storage, backup services, etc.). IT administrators
also define what types of approvals are required prior
to virtual machine deployment.
After the initial setup is completed, users can log
into Lifecycle Manager and submit requests for virtual
machines. During the request process, users specify
the service template and quality of service they need.
Based on these request criteria, Lifecycle Manager can
determine the specific resources that best support the
request. For example, a request for a production virtual
machine requiring high performance will be mapped to
the highest performing server, network and storage resources
available in the virtualized environment.
Once submitted, requests are forwarded to an IT administrator
for review and approval. If approved, automated virtual
machine provisioning and placement occurs based on previously
defined lifecycle management policies. Users receive
notification via email when their virtual machines are
deployed and accessible.
When a virtual machine reaches the end of its lifecycle,
Lifecycle Manager will decommission it. The decommission
process, which consists of an optional archiving step
and ultimately deleting a virtual machine, provides
better resource utilization by ensuring resources come
back into the resource pool for future use. If needed,
users can request a lifecycle extension that must be
reviewed and approved by an IT administrator instead
of letting the virtual machine be decommissioned.

Service Catalog
Standardize VM provisioning requests with a set of
pre-defined virtual machine templates provided by IT.
- Service Catalog: Provide a standardized set
of virtual machine configurations according to IT
policies.
- Service Tiers: Define what quality of service
levels get configured during VM deployment (availability,
security, monitoring).
- Web-based: Available to users via a web browser
from anywhere on the corporate network
Task Automation
Automate routine lifecycle management tasks, reclaim
unused resources and enforce IT policies across virtual
machine deployments.
- Provisioning and Change Requests: Automate virtual
machine guest customization, system and network
configuration tasks based on pre-defined policies.
- Resource Reclamation: Automatically free up
resources by decommissioning virtual machines that
have reached the end of their lifecycle.
- Auto Import: Apply Lifecycle Manager policies
to existing virtual environments.
Administrative Control
Centralize virtual machine requests and streamline
the approval process with the Lifecycle Manager web
portal. The portal is also used to establish the service
catalog, configure resource mappings and define placement
policies.
- Request Portal: Provide single portal for users,
approvers and administrators to streamline VM request,
change and approval processes.
- Placement Policies: Establish policies to assign
groups of users to specific server, storage and
network resource pools.
- Tracking & Reporting: Easily track the status
of virtual machines through request, approval, provisioning,
and decommissioning.
Enterprise Ready
Lifecycle Manager is designed to easily fit into
existing environments and scale in support of thousands
of VM deployments across multiple datacenters. Integrations
with third- party enterprise management systems create
a seamless solution for end-to-end management of provisioning
workflows across physical and virtual infrastructure.
- Enterprise Scalability: Connect Lifecycle Manager
to multiple virtual datacenters to manage all VM
provisioning requests from a central location.
- Fully customizable: Adapt existing workflows
or implement new ones to better fit your needs.
- LDAP Support: Connect Lifecycle Manager to user
authentication systems to centrally manage access
control in the corporate environment.
- Third-party integrations: Seamlessly integrate
Lifecycle Manager with existing management systems
for end-to-end management of provisioning workflows
across physical and virtual infrastructure.
